如何压缩多个文件\文件夹(GZipStream and C#)

时间:2013-05-03 06:37:17
【文件属性】:

文件名称:如何压缩多个文件\文件夹(GZipStream and C#)

文件大小:71KB

文件格式:RAR

更新时间:2013-05-03 06:37:17

压缩 解压 GZipStream

在.Net Framework 2.0 中添加了System.IO.Compression 类来实现对文件/文件夹的压缩/解压(GZipStream方法),包括文档,代码,类文件


【文件预览】:
Code
----CompressProject.sln(935B)
----CompressProject.suo(17KB)
----CompressProject()
--------CompressProject.csproj(5KB)
--------Compress.cs(24KB)
--------bin()
--------Web.config(7KB)
--------obj()
--------Properties()
--------CompressProject.csproj.user(1KB)
--------App_Data()
--------Default.aspx(1KB)
--------TestCompress()
--------Default.aspx.cs(2KB)
--------Default.aspx.designer.cs(2KB)
--------SampleCompress.cs(2KB)
Compress.cs
如何压缩多个文件§文件夹(GZipStream and C#).doc

网友评论

  • 不能用,最后从外网上找了一段
  • 可以用11111
  • 法国恢复规划法规
  • 虽然没有想象中完美,不过也挺好的,感谢!
  • 谢谢分享!自己稍做处理,解决了我的需求。谢谢!
  • 可用,但不通用!
  • 虽然效果没有想象那么完美,不过我改了改还是很受用的,谢谢分享
  • 压缩带文件夹得有问题
  • 谢谢分享可以使用
  • 只能压缩整个文件夹,不能选择性压缩
  • 无法使用其他解压工具解压,最后还是用的第三方程序集实现的
  • 只能自己解压文件,无法使用其他工具解压 还是感谢了
  • 可以压缩,但只能解压自己压缩的文件
  • 还行吧,但不是理想中的代码!
  • 很有用,问题解决了!
  • 可以用的啊
  • 可是使用,但是不太好用。
  • 呃,大家都说可以用但是我技术比较粗糙没弄明白,一直调试不成功...最后在http://www.cnblogs.com/terer/articles/1588717.html看到了一个方法很简单就实现了,但是不知道面对有子文件夹会怎么处理,只是满足了我压缩内含多个文件的文件夹的需要
  • 只能自己解压文件,无法使用其他工具解压,不是公共规范的压缩解压方式
  • 很好,可以用
  • 可以压缩,解压的时候可以用密码解压,压缩没有输入密码的地方,不知道怎么改进
  • 可以使用,但只能生成zip格式,有生成rar格式的代码没?
  • 可以压缩,但只能解压自己压缩的文件
  • 压缩是可以压缩,但是无法添加文件头啊。
  • 压缩是可以压缩,但是无法添加文件头啊。
  • 坑爹啊...根本 就不是公共规范的压缩解压方式
  • 已经在项目中用上了,不错。